What is this badge about?

Cookie flavors, a sales goal, and make a sales plan and pitch.

Choose your own activities!

Our Summary* of requirements:

  1. Learn the flavors, costs, and which ones are vegan, gluten-free, etc.
  2. Brainstorm ideas and then vote on what the troop goal for spending cookie money will be.
  3. Make something to track your sales progress to your goal, or use the online sales tracker.
  4. Create a plan with role play/talk with cookie experts OR practice teamwork and apply what you learned to cookie business.
  5. Make a sales pitch and practice, create a video, or write it down.

* – This summary is based off the GSUSA booklet activity choices.

GSUSA Information and Details

Five steps are needed to complete this badge:

  1. Find out about Cookies
  2. Decide how you will spend your cookie money
  3. Set a troop budget and package goal
  4. Build your team
  5. Create your pitch to customers
